Who Is Beyoncé? A Quick Bio
Before we get into the nitty-gritty of the sextape rumors, let’s take a moment to appreciate who Beyoncé really is. Born Beyoncé Giselle Knowles on September 4, 1981, in Houston, Texas, she’s more than just a singer. She’s a dancer, actress, songwriter, and businesswoman who’s built an empire worth billions.
Key Facts About Beyoncé
Here’s a quick rundown of Beyoncé’s life and career:
- Beyoncé rose to fame as the lead singer of Destiny’s Child, one of the best-selling girl groups of all time.
- She launched her solo career in 2003 with the album "Dangerously in Love," which spawned hits like "Crazy in Love" and "Baby Boy."
- Beyoncé has won over 30 Grammy Awards, making her one of the most awarded artists in history.
- She’s married to rapper and entrepreneur Jay-Z, with whom she shares three children: Blue Ivy, Rumi, and Sir.

The Legal Implications of Sextape Leaks
Now, let’s talk about the legal side of things. In recent years, there’s been a growing awareness of the dangers of non-consensual sharing of intimate images, also known as "revenge porn." Many countries have enacted laws to protect individuals from this kind of abuse.
In the United States, for example, distributing intimate images without consent can result in criminal charges, including fines and jail time. And if the victim is a public figure like Beyoncé, the consequences can be even more severe.
